Loading...
Please wait, while we are loading the content...
Similar Documents
Utilizing user interface models for automated instantiation and execution of system tests.
| Content Provider | CiteSeerX |
|---|---|
| Author | Hauptmann, Benedikt Junker, Maximilian |
| Abstract | Scripts for automated system tests often contain technical knowledge about the user interface (UI). This makes test scripts brittle and hard to maintain which leads to high maintenance costs. As a consequence, automation of sys-tem tests is often abandoned. We present a model-driven approach that separates UI knowledge from test scripts. Tests are defined on a higher level, abstracting from UI usage. During test instantiation, abstract tests are enriched with UI information and executed against the system. We demonstrate the application of our approach to graphical UIs (GUIs) such as rich clients and web applications. To show the feasibility, we present a proto-typical implementation testing the open-source application Bugzilla. |
| File Format | |
| Access Restriction | Open |
| Subject Keyword | System Test User Interface Model Automated Instantiation Test Script Rich Client Proto-typical Implementation Technical Knowledge Ui Usage Abstract Test High Maintenance Cost Automated System Test Sys-tem Test Open-source Application Bugzilla Model-driven Approach Test Instantiation User Interface Ui Information Web Application Ui Knowledge Graphical Uis |
| Content Type | Text |